Importers and Exporters
Impact on Cost of Goods
The impact of the USD to PKR exchange rate on the cost of goods plays a vital role in the overall operations of importers and exporters. Fluctuations in the exchange rate can directly affect the price of imported goods, influencing the competitiveness of products in the market. For importers, a stronger USD relative to the PKR may increase the cost of imported goods, leading to higher expenses and potentially reduced profit margins. Conversely, exporters benefit from a weaker USD, as it makes their goods more competitive in international markets.

General Public and Consumers
The USD to PKR exchange rate impacts the general public and consumers by influencing purchasing power and travel expenses. Understanding how currency fluctuations affect domestic prices and travel costs is essential for individuals managing personal finances and planning international trips.
Purchasing Power
Purchasing power is directly correlated to the USD to PKR exchange rate, determining the affordability of imported goods and services for consumers. A stronger PKR relative to the USD may increase purchasing power, allowing individuals to buy more goods with the same amount of money. On the contrary, a weaker PKR can erode purchasing power, leading to higher prices and potentially reducing the standard of living for consumers.
